Elara stood at the precipice of a sorrow so immense it felt like the sky itself had wept itself empty. Before her, the Grey Being pulsed with a mournful, colorless light, a vast expanse of loneliness that had spread like a stain across the world. The air around it was thick with the absence of feeling, a heavy blanket that threatened to smother the last flickering embers of her own spirit. Yet, within that vast emptiness, Elara saw not a monster, but a creature broken, a being drowning in its own silent scream for connection.

Her hands, which had so recently learned to perceive the shimmering, vibrant threads of emotion, now felt clumsy and inadequate. The heart threads of Lumina, once bright and strong, were now frayed and dim, barely visible against the encroaching grey. But here, before the source of that grey, it was as if the threads had never existed at all. It was a void, a chilling testament to the power of isolation.

“It’s so… empty,” she whispered, her voice barely a breath against the profound silence. Flicker, perched on her shoulder, shivered, its usually bright glow muted to a faint, worried pulse. It nudged her cheek with its tiny head, a silent question: *Are you sure, Elara?*
